The Itinerary — What You Can Expect

The tour begins with a pick-up from your accommodation in Auckland, Hamilton, Rotorua, or Tauranga. You’ll travel in an air-conditioned, WiFi-equipped vehicle—making the journey as comfortable as the destination. Onboard, the driver/guide shares interesting tidbits about New Zealand, Hobbiton, and the surrounding areas, making the trip part of the experience.
Once you arrive at Hobbiton, you’ll be introduced to the set with a fully guided tour at dusk. Expect to walk through the charming Hobbit village, stopping at key spots like Bilbo’s house, the party tree, and the Green Dragon Inn. The setting, especially in the evening light, is magical and creates the perfect backdrop for photos.
After the tour, you’ll head inside the Green Dragon Inn for your two-course banquet feast, served with a Hobbit-style Southfarthing Ale. The reviews emphasize that the food is very good, and the convivial setting makes everyone feel like part of a Hobbit family.
Following dinner, you’ll enjoy a lantern-lit walk through the village, letting the quiet beauty of Hobbiton settle in. This walk is part of what makes this experience stand out—lighting lanterns and strolling through the set at night feels like stepping into a fairy tale.

Practical Considerations

- The tour requires comfortable walking shoes because you’ll be walking around Hobbiton, though the terrain is generally accessible.
- It’s a private tour, so only your group participates, but a minimum of two people is needed to operate.
- The tour is weather-dependent—bad weather may lead to rescheduling or a full refund.
- The experience is suitable for most travelers unless mobility or weather is a concern.

Is this tour suitable for children?
The experience involves walking around Hobbiton at dusk and a fairly relaxed dinner, so children who are comfortable walking and can enjoy the gentle outdoor environment should be fine. However, it’s best for older kids or teens who understand the films and stories.
What is included in the price?
The tour price covers private transportation, guided tour of Hobbiton at dusk, entry tickets, a two-course banquet feast, snacks, bottled water, and all taxes and fees.
Can I join this tour if I’m staying outside Auckland?
Yes, pickup is available from Auckland, Hamilton, Rotorua, or Tauranga, making it flexible regardless of your base in New Zealand.
What should I bring?
Comfortable walking shoes are recommended. Since it’s an outdoor setting at dusk, a light jacket or layers might be useful. The tour provides snacks and drinks, but you may want to bring cash or cards for additional purchases.
How long does the tour last?
Approximately 10 hours including travel time. The core experience at Hobbiton is about 5 hours, with the rest dedicated to transportation and downtime.
Is this tour weather-dependent?
Yes, bad weather may cause rescheduling or refunds. It’s a good idea to check the forecast and be flexible if possible.
